The article is fairly long, but here's the first few paragraphs:
On Saturday, as U.S. officials and their foreign allies scrambled to understand how dozens of classified intelligence documents had ended up on the internet, they were stunned — and occasionally infuriated — at the extraordinary range of detail the files exposed about how the United States spies on friends and foes alike.

The documents, which appear to have come at least in part from the Pentagon and are marked as highly classified, offer tactical information about the war in Ukraine, including the country’s combat capabilities. According to one defense official, many of the documents seem to have been prepared over the winter for Gen. Mark A. Milley, ch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ff, and other senior military officials, but they were available to other U.S. personnel and contract employees with the requisite security clearances.

Other documents include analysis from U.S. intelligence agencies about Russia and several other countries, all based on information gleaned from classified sources.
Some interesting info re. the war in the Ukraine:
The documents also demonstrate what has long been understood but never publicly spelled out this precisely: The U.S. intelligence community has penetrated the Russian military and its commanders so deeply that it can warn Ukraine in advance of attacks and reliably assess the strengths and weaknesses of Russian forces.

A single page in the leaked trove reveals that the U.S. intelligence community knew the Russian Ministry of Defense had transmitted plans to strike Ukrainian troop positions in two locations on a certain date in February and that Russian military planners were preparing strikes on a dozen energy facilities and an equal number of bridges in Ukraine.

Aric Toller of Bellingcat is freelancing for the New York Times, where he's the lead reporter on this story, in which the Times identifies the leader of the forum:

"The national guardsman, whose name is Jack Teixeira, oversaw a private online group named Thug Shaker Central, where about 20 to 30 people, mostly young men and teenagers, came together over a shared love of guns, racist online memes and video games."

To be clear: Teixeira, who is "enlisted in the 102nd Intelligence Wing of the Massachusetts Air National Guard," is not believed to be the person who posted the classified documents. But it seems pretty clear that U.S. intelligence agencies are going to find that person right quick, if they haven't already done so.

This is interesting. Unconfirmed, but shared by the usually reliable Michael Weiss.

Donbass Devushka is a pro-Russian Telegram account with an occasionally disappearing Russian access, who claimed to be in Luhansk. She appears to be a US Navy Clerk who was just discharged. Donbass Devushka was one of the original leakers of the Pentagon documents taken by Jack Teixeria.

It's been revealed that the Discord group where Teixeria posted the document had a number of members outside the US, including Russia.



Update: now published by WSJ, which names Washington-state-based former U.S. enlisted aviation electronics technician Sarah Bils as the blogger who was treated by the vatnik crowd as a reliable source of information from Luhansk.

BREAKING: The United States Department of Justice just announced huge arrests. These included 2 Complaints that charge 30 officers with the China’s national security force (NPS) and multiple NY residents as well. The NPS has violated our sovereignty including opening a police station in New York City.

In an office building in Chinatown it was discovered that there was an undeclared police station of the Chinese National Police. These individuals were acting as agents of a foreign government and the secret police station was used locate a US resident on US soil as well as take other illegal actions.

Additionally Chinese dissidents were being targeted by an NPS task force via troll farms. They spread conspiracy theories on COVD and US political matters. More details coming.

The New York Times has a new report about Jack Teixeira with this headline: "Airman Shared Sensitive Intelligence More Widely and for Longer Than Previously Known." He'd been posting classified information since February 2022 to a different Discord group with 600 users; this "chat room was publicly listed on a YouTube channel and was easily accessed in seconds." Teixeira's posts with leaked information started two days after Russia launched its 2022 invasion into Ukraine.
